The Norwegian Second Division, also called 2. divisjon and often referred to as PostNord-ligaen for sponsorship reasons, is the third-highest level of the Norwegian football league system.

The 4 teams relegated from the 1. divisjon and the 12 teams promoted from the 3. divisjon, will join the 40 teams positioned in 2nd to 11th place in last season's 2. divisjon.
